What companies run services between Milan, Italy and Levanto, Italy?
Trenitalia Intercity operates a train from Milano Centrale to Levanto hourly. Tickets cost €22–50 and the journey takes 2h 49m. Trenord also services this route twice a week.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Milano, Autostazione Lampugnano to Chiavari 5 times a week. Tickets cost €14–23 and the journey takes 3h 35m.
